Cap
Clothing/Dress/Costume
Entirely hand stitched fine white cotton cap. Flat horseshoe crown joined to brim with Ayreshire insertion; brim made of two sections, one ruched and the front on a panel of eyelet. Fine frill all around, edged with a narrow fold of net. Flat linen tape drawstring in back. Little bar tacks on corners to receive ribbon ties. “Inked “M. Brookes 1835”
